Output edd85257e2bd9c528dddbdfd1d633404e105b0ee4141a06f30bef80e576fb163:1

value
684582
script pubkey
OP_0 OP_PUSHBYTES_20 33c65dc571ec96223ebca84184f40f6600bbccd2
address
bc1qx0r9m3t3ajtzy04u4pqcfaq0vcqthnxjl5g3jg
transaction
edd85257e2bd9c528dddbdfd1d633404e105b0ee4141a06f30bef80e576fb163
confirmations
62435
spent
true